Bạn biết đấy, khi mọi người hỏi tôi nonce trong crypto là gì, tôi nhận ra hầu hết họ không thực sự hiểu tầm quan trọng của khái niệm này đối với mọi thứ liên quan đến blockchain. Hãy để tôi giải thích theo cách thực sự dễ hiểu.



Vì cơ bản, nonce đại diện cho 'số dùng một lần' - và chính xác đó là chức năng của nó. Đó là một số ngẫu nhiên được tạo ra để các thợ mỏ sử dụng một lần cho mỗi giao dịch mã hóa. Hãy nghĩ nó như một biện pháp bảo mật giúp hệ thống không bị sụp đổ. Nếu không có nó, việc khai thác blockchain sẽ trở thành một mớ hỗn độn.

Điều đặc biệt về nonce trong crypto mà nhiều người thường bỏ qua là gì. Khi một thợ mỏ làm việc trên một khối, họ lấy dữ liệu giao dịch và gắn số ngẫu nhiên này vào đó. Sau đó, họ băm tất cả cùng nhau bằng SHA-256. Hash kết quả sẽ được so sánh với một giá trị mục tiêu do mức độ khó của mạng quy định. Nếu phù hợp? Khối được thêm vào chuỗi và thợ mỏ nhận phần thưởng. Đơn giản vậy thôi.

Nhưng tại sao điều này lại quan trọng đến vậy? Bởi vì nếu không có nonce, dữ liệu giao dịch cùng một có thể bị gửi đi đi gửi lại nhiều lần. Thợ mỏ có thể cứ giữ nguyên khối và liên tục nhận thưởng. Nonce đảm bảo mỗi khối đều hoàn toàn duy nhất. Mỗi khối có yếu tố ngẫu nhiên riêng biệt. Sự ngẫu nhiên này cực kỳ cần thiết cho an ninh mạng - nó ngăn chặn các thợ mỏ gian lận hệ thống.

Vậy nonce trong crypto thực sự là gì? Nó chính là cơ chế làm cho bằng chứng công việc (proof-of-work) hoạt động. Trong các hệ thống như Bitcoin, thợ mỏ thực sự cạnh tranh để tìm ra giá trị hash hợp lệ. Người đầu tiên giải được sẽ nhận phần thưởng khối. Nonce là thứ buộc họ phải thử nhiều tổ hợp khác nhau cho đến khi đạt mục tiêu. Chính sự ngẫu nhiên này làm cho cuộc thi trở nên hợp lệ.

Độ khó của mạng cũng liên quan đến điều này. Khi nhiều sức mạnh tính toán hơn tham gia mạng, độ khó tự điều chỉnh. Giá trị mục tiêu thay đổi, yêu cầu nhiều lần thử hơn để tìm ra hash hợp lệ. Nhưng nonce vẫn giữ vai trò then chốt - chính là yếu tố ngẫu nhiên giúp mọi thứ trung thực. Độ khó tăng lên chỉ làm thợ mỏ cần nhiều sức mạnh hơn và nhiều lần thử hơn, nhưng nguyên tắc về nonce vẫn không thay đổi.

Tôi nghĩ nhiều người chưa nhận thức hết sự tinh tế của giải pháp này. Hiểu nonce trong crypto thực sự là hiểu tại sao blockchain lại chống sửa đổi được. Nếu không có thành phần số ngẫu nhiên này, toàn bộ mô hình an ninh sẽ sụp đổ. Nó không chỉ là một chi tiết kỹ thuật - đó là nền tảng để các mạng phi tập trung có thể hoạt động mà không cần trung tâm kiểm soát. Đó chính là mục đích của toàn bộ hệ thống.
Xem bản gốc
Trang này có thể chứa nội dung của bên thứ ba, được cung cấp chỉ nhằm mục đích thông tin (không phải là tuyên bố/bảo đảm) và không được coi là sự chứng thực cho quan điểm của Gate hoặc là lời khuyên về tài chính hoặc chuyên môn. Xem Tuyên bố từ chối trách nhiệm để biết chi tiết.
  • Phần thưởng
  • Bình luận
  • Đăng lại
  • Retweed
Bình luận
Thêm một bình luận
Thêm một bình luận
Không có bình luận
  • Ghim